As a native Wichitan, the mascot is supposed to be a shock of wheat, hence the name "Shocker." Needless to say everyone at WSU will hold up ...

A "shocker" is one who harvests wheat. So while it sounds odd, "Shockers" has regional significance and a substantive backstory, which is really all you want in a nickname. Bringing you closer to the Shockers you love and inside the sports ...Feb 28, 2017 · The Wichita State Shockers, of course, got their name as this is the wheat capital of the world. Their wheat shock mascot, better known as WuShock, got its nickname from wheat shocking. “A lot of football players’ summer jobs were shocking wheat in the summer, then they’d play football in the fall for WSU,” Poland said. Sep 18, 2010 · 1. The Story of WuShock Marker. Inscription. It was 1904 when Wichita State University was known as Fairmoun [t] College that R.J. Kirk (Class of 1907), a football manager, invented the name "Wheat Shockers" for posters to advertise a game against the Chilocco Indians. It was shortened to "Shockers" as Wichita State teams are known today.
